Output 6e43aeb8a1267a48edf69138ab09647bb55b76f427608ff8bc461bd8e13526bc:0

value
3745555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a977be8b3ba7a343e3407b964a23e1da2343c586 OP_EQUAL
address
3H95Zwh3HEENxMYRZecCh1S6y3KePa5Ggn
transaction
6e43aeb8a1267a48edf69138ab09647bb55b76f427608ff8bc461bd8e13526bc
confirmations
285882
spent
true